English Delivery Only: MySQL Performance & Tuning [STA_MYSDBAPT]

Durée totale
Localisation
A cet endroit
Date et lieu de début

English Delivery Only: MySQL Performance & Tuning [STA_MYSDBAPT]

Global Knowledge Belgium BV
Logo Global Knowledge Belgium BV
Note du fournisseur: starstarstar_halfstar_borderstar_border 4,5 Global Knowledge Belgium BV a une moyenne de 4,5 (basée sur 2 avis)

Astuce: besoin de plus d'informations sur la formation? Téléchargez la brochure!

Dates et lieux de début
placeVirtual
26 fév. 2026 jusqu'au 27 fév. 2026
Description

Vrijwel iedere training die op een onze locaties worden getoond zijn ook te volgen vanaf huis via Virtual Classroom training. Dit kunt u bij uw inschrijving erbij vermelden dat u hiervoor kiest.

OVERVIEW

*** Course delivered in English (UK - (GMT)) ***

MySQL Performance & Tuning Course Overview

This MySQL Performance & Tuning course is designed for Database Administrators,Application Developers and Technical Consultants who

OBJECTIVES

Course Objectives

To provide the skills necessary to monitor and tune MySQL database performance.

AUDIENCE

Who will the Course Benefit?

Anyone who needs to monitor and tune the performance of MySQL databases.

NEXT STEP

Further Learning

  • Apache Web Server

CONTENT

MySQL Performance & Tuning Training Course

Course Contents - DAY 1

Course Introduction

  • Administration and Course Materials
  • Course Structure and Agenda
  • Delegate and Trainer Introductions

Sess…

Lisez la description complète ici

Foire aux questions (FAQ)

Il n'y a pour le moment aucune question fréquente sur ce produit. Si vous avez besoin d'aide ou une question, contactez notre équipe support.

Vous n'avez pas trouvé ce que vous cherchiez ? Voir aussi : SQL, Cours d'anglais, Data management, Administration des serveurs et Unified Modeling Language (UML).

Vrijwel iedere training die op een onze locaties worden getoond zijn ook te volgen vanaf huis via Virtual Classroom training. Dit kunt u bij uw inschrijving erbij vermelden dat u hiervoor kiest.

OVERVIEW

*** Course delivered in English (UK - (GMT)) ***

MySQL Performance & Tuning Course Overview

This MySQL Performance & Tuning course is designed for Database Administrators,Application Developers and Technical Consultants who

OBJECTIVES

Course Objectives

To provide the skills necessary to monitor and tune MySQL database performance.

AUDIENCE

Who will the Course Benefit?

Anyone who needs to monitor and tune the performance of MySQL databases.

NEXT STEP

Further Learning

  • Apache Web Server

CONTENT

MySQL Performance & Tuning Training Course

Course Contents - DAY 1

Course Introduction

  • Administration and Course Materials
  • Course Structure and Agenda
  • Delegate and Trainer Introductions

Session 1: INTRODUCTION TO PERFORMANCE TUNING

  • Tuning Overview
  • Resolving Performance Issues
  • Recommended Approach to Tuning
  • Items to Evaluate
  • Where to look for performance issues
  • Develop a monitoring and tuning plan
  • Building a New Database for Performance
  • Tuning an Existing Database for performance
  • Set Suitable performance goals

Session 2: MYSQL PERFORMANCE TUNING TOOLS

  • Tuning Overview
  • Hardware optimization
  • Increase RAM and use faster RAM
  • Use more CPU cores
  • Use a clustered database
  • Optimize the operating system
  • Use indexes to improve performance
  • Optimize queries
  • Optimize tables
  • Assign suitable memory allocations
  • Set values for system variables that affect performance
  • Use benchmarking tool

Session 3: STATEMENT TUNING

  • Overview of Statement Tuning
  • Identifying and improve Problem Queries
  • The Optimizer
  • Understand the output from the Explain command
  • Monitor queries using the Information Schema Processlist table
  • Optimization strategies
  • Optimizations for derived tables
  • Filesort with small LIMIT optimization
  • Limit rows examined
  • Query limits and timeouts
  • Abort statements that exceed a specific time to execute

Session 4: INDEXES

  • An overview of MariaDB indexes
  • Types of MySQL indexes
  • Make efficient usage of indexes
  • Assess the size of an Index
  • Resolve queries without accessing some tables referred to in the query
  • Force query plans using index hints
  • Find rows in a table using named indexes
  • Ignore indexes using an index hint
  • How indexes impact table joins
  • InnoDB Cached Indexes Information

MySQL Performance & Tuning Training Course

Course Contents - DAY 2

Session 5: SERVER CONFIGURATION AND MONITORING

  • Set suitable values for server configuration variables
  • Use server status variables to monitor performance
  • Use table caching
  • Store key distributions for a table with the ANALYZE TABLE command
  • Reclaim unused space and defragment data with the OPTIMIZE TABLE command
  • Use multi-threading
  • Solve connection issues

Session 6: THE INNODB ENGINE

  • Transactions
  • Crash recovery with the innodb engine
  • Effects of innodb locking on performance
  • Monitoring InnoDB Locks in MySQL
  • MySQL Disable Deadlock Detection
  • Monitor the performance of the InnoDB engine
  • Set and monitor caches and buffers
  • Configuring data files for performance
  • Configuring the log files for performance

Session 7: OVERVIEW OF CLUSTERING FOR PERFORMANCE

  • The Performance Advantages of Clustering
  • Performance Issues and Clustering
  • The NDB Cluster
  • The Galera Cluster
  • The Percona XtraDB Cluster
  • MySQL InnoDB Cluster
  • The Federated Engine

Session 8: OPTIMIZING THE PERFORMANCE OF DUMPING AND LOADING DATA

  • SQL statements versus delimited data
  • Parameters affecting dump performance
  • Parameters affecting load performance

Session 9: PARTITIONING TABLES FOR PERFORMANCE

  • The concept of partitioned tables
  • How partitioning can improve performance
  • Range partitioning
  • Hash partitioning
  • Key partitioning
  • List partitioning
  • Composite partitioning or subpartitioning
  • Partition Pruning
  • Adding,dropping and coalescing partitions
  • Convert a non-partitioned table to a partitioned table
Rester à jour sur les nouveaux avi
Pas encore d'avis.
Partagez vos avis
Avez-vous participé à cours? Partagez votre expérience et aider d'autres personnes à faire le bon choix. Pour vous remercier, nous donnerons 1,00 € à la fondation Stichting Edukans.

Il n'y a pour le moment aucune question fréquente sur ce produit. Si vous avez besoin d'aide ou une question, contactez notre équipe support.

Recevoir une brochure d'information (gratuit)

(optionnel)
(optionnel)
(optionnel)
(optionnel)
(optionnel)
(optionnel)

Vous avez des questions?

(optionnel)
Nous conservons vos données personnelles dans le but de vous accompagner par email ou téléphone.
Vous pouvez trouver plus d'informations sur : Politique de confidentialité.